Ratings & Tasting Notes:
James Suckling Aromas of peat and fruits, with hints of cedar and berries. Full and velvety with good fruit and a medium finish. Goes mushroomy. (3/2012)
Wine Advocate A successful wine for Lafite, this dark ruby/purple-colored 1993 is tightly-wound, medium-bodied, with a closed set of aromatics that reluctantly reveal hints of sweet blackcurrant fruit, weedy tobacco, and lead pencil scents. Polished and elegant, with Lafite’s noble restraint, this is an excellent, classy, slightly austere wine. (RP) (2/1997)
Wine Spectator Very polished and well-crafted black cherry, toast, earth and mineral flavors, all in nice proportions. Medium body, supple tannins. (JS) (1/1996)
